Runbook: Scanline barcode bridge

If warehouse scans stop flowing into Cartwheel, it's almost always the bridge service on the Dunmore floor box wedging after a USB hiccup. Bounce the service first — nine times out of ten that fixes it. If not, check the queue depth before escalating. When restarting, make sure the bridge comes up with these settings.

deployment values, yafop-bajef:
[gilok]
team = ulaius
access_code = ac_423664
host = gilok.sivrelhq.corp
port = 9200
owner = pelius.istax
peer = eliok.torvasoft.internal

☐ Flagwright rollout framework: confirm all active flags have expiry dates, kill switches tested this quarter, and stale flags (>90 days) removed or ticketed. Verify staged-rollout percentages match the approved plan and audit log is complete. Discrepancies block the release train. Raise findings at the weekly eng sync. Sign-off required from the accountable owner named below.

named custodian: Brivan Eliath Quenox Frador

TICKET — Missed Pick-up

Regional chess final (Thornbury Open) wrapped Sunday; official score sheets were boxed and left at the Ashgate Community Hall front desk for collection. Scheduled pick-up did not occur. Federation needs the sheets for ratings verification by Friday. One sealed box, clearly marked. Reassign to the next available run and confirm collection time with the hall caretaker. Confidential courier hand-over instruction follows below.

courier memo of tawep-tajep: the quenius ulaiel courier leaves the fenir ledger at gate 9128 under passcode 527513

### Changed defaults

Addrsnap widget now debounces keystrokes at 250ms (was 100ms) and caps suggestions at 6 (was 10) after latency complaints from the Northharrow rollout. Minimum query length raised to 3 characters. Fuzzy matching stays off by default. No API changes; consumers overriding these keys are unaffected. Verify downstream snapshot tests against the new defaults, which are listed below.

settings of tagef-bawif:
DRUIX_HOST=druix.zemvarlabs.internal
DRUIX_PORT=8000